Q: Is 155,160,201 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 155,160,201 is a composite number.

Why is 155,160,201 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 155,160,201 can be evenly divided by 1 3 7 21 151 167 293 453 501 879 1,057 1,169 2,051 3,171 3,507 6,153 25,217 44,243 48,931 75,651 132,729 146,793 176,519 309,701 342,517 529,557 929,103 1,027,551 7,388,581 22,165,743 51,720,067 and 155,160,201, with no remainder.

Since 155,160,201 cannot be divided by just 1 and 155,160,201, it is a composite number.
